What I Look for Before Buying
Before I buy any knife block, I always check a few important things. First, I look at the size of the block to make sure it fits my countertop. Then I think about how many knives I want to store now and in the future. I also pay attention to the material because it affects durability, cleaning, and overall style.
Types of Knife Blocks I Prefer
I have found that there are a few styles worth considering. Traditional slot blocks are great if I want a classic look. Universal knife blocks work well when I want flexibility because they can hold different blade sizes. Magnetic blocks are also appealing to me since they save space and make my knives easy to grab.
Material Matters to Me
In my experience, the material makes a big difference. Wooden blocks usually feel sturdy and look warm and classic in my kitchen. Bamboo is a favorite of mine because it is lightweight and eco-friendly. Stainless steel and acrylic options feel more modern, and I like them when I want something sleek and easy to match with other appliances.
Safety Features I Always Check
Safety is one of my biggest concerns. I prefer a knife block that holds each knife securely so the blades do not move around. I also like blocks with non-slip bases because they stay stable on my counter. If I choose a universal block, I make sure it has a design that protects the blades from dulling too quickly.
Cleaning and Maintenance
I always think about how easy the block will be to clean. Some knife blocks collect crumbs or dust inside, so I look for designs that are simple to maintain. If I want less hassle, I usually go for a block with removable inserts or an open design that is easier to wipe down.
My Thoughts on Design and Kitchen Fit
Since the knife block stays on my countertop, I want it to look good too. I usually choose a style that matches my kitchen decor and does not take up too much space. A compact design works best for my smaller kitchen, while a larger block makes sense if I have more knives and more counter space.
